Nathan Calvin, a US-based lawyer working on AI regulations, claimed OpenAI sent police to his house at night to serve a subpoena. "They...asked me to turn over private texts and emails with...legislators, college students and former OpenAI employees," Calvin said. "Going against the highest-valued private company in the world is terrifying," he added.
